首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>专栏 >RuoYi.Net.Vue3 若依.NetCore版

RuoYi.Net.Vue3 若依.NetCore版

作者头像
办公魔盒
发布2024-11-25 09:59:57
发布2024-11-25 09:59:57
91500
代码可运行
举报
文章被收录于专栏:办公魔盒办公魔盒
运行总次数:0
代码可运行

介绍

本项目是基wdyday大佬的https://gitee.com/wdyday/RuoYi.Net 版把若依vue3前端搬过来,并修复了部分bug

项目地址

代码语言:javascript
代码运行次数:0
运行
复制
原项目地址:https://gitee.com/wdyday/RuoYi.Net
https://gitee.com/wxvbee/ruoyinetvue3.git
https://git.bgmh.work/ouhuanhua/RuoYi.Net.Vue3.git
https://github.com/baxiprince/RuoYi.NetCore.Vue3.git

项目下载

可以通过git直接克隆项目,也可以访问上面的地址把项目Download下来

初始化项目-后端服务

1.创建一个数据库,把项目RuoYi.Net下sql文件夹下的sql脚本导入数据库mysql和sqlserver根据实际导入

2.修改RuoYi.Net\RuoYi.Admin后端服务的数据库连接配置信息

3.修改完直接启动项目即可,指令:dotnet run没有报错表示配置成功

初始化前端服务

1.进入vue3目录RuoYi-Vue3,启动cmd,并保证你安装的nodejs版本大于等于v18,然后执行以下指令安装yarn(已安装可以忽略)

代码语言:javascript
代码运行次数:0
运行
复制
npm install -g yarn

2.执行以下执行初始化前端项目,没有报错即表示成功

代码语言:javascript
代码运行次数:0
运行
复制
yarn install

3.然后执行以下指令运行前端项目,启动成功会自动跳转浏览器登录,然后数据账号密码即可登录,默认账号/密码:admin/admin123

代码语言:javascript
代码运行次数:0
运行
复制
开发环境:yarn dev
生产环境:yarn prod

新增自己的项目

1.新增一个测试项目,打开RuoYi.Net.sln项目文件(vs2019+),右键添加项目

2.添加类库项目(语言可以是c#或vb.net,但是vb.net不能新的语法)

3.RuoYi.Admin项目引用刚刚创建的类库项目

4.添加控制器文件夹,并创建一个控制器或者直接代码生成(这里演示的是代码生成)

4.1.先创建一个测试表,并添加测试数据

4.2.回到代码生成页面,导入刚刚创建的测试表,并点击生成代码

4.3.把生成打代码复制到项目,net是后端代码,vue是前端代码,把压缩包的全部代码复制到刚创建的项目下

4.4.新建的项目添加项目引用,并处理一些异常引用

4.5.把错误处理好后就可以直接启动了

4.5.1.测试生成的代码api路由是否正确或数据返回

代码语言:javascript
代码运行次数:0
运行
复制
http://localhost/dev-api/system/test/list

4.5.2.经测试没问题,后面就可以实现自己的逻辑代码了

前端代码使用

1.vscode打开vue文件夹,展开src/views路径,然后把前端views代码丢进去

2.展开src/api把js代码丢进去,前端服务会自动在后台编译代码

3.返回后端页面,添加目录,在目录下添加菜单,然后刷新页面即可

前端项目端口修改

后端服务端口修改

更多的教程可以参考JAVA版若依教程

代码语言:javascript
代码运行次数:0
运行
复制
https://doc.ruoyi.vip/
本文参与 腾讯云自媒体同步曝光计划,分享自微信公众号。
原始发表:2024-11-09,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 办公魔盒 微信公众号,前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体同步曝光计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档